Delicious sandwiches, 10 bucks each which isn’t bad at all for how high quality the produce is. Had the«Lax rulle,» normally with Smoked Norwegian salmon, red cabbage slaw, and horseradish crème. However, I substituted smoked tuna for the salmon/lox. He said why not so it was allowed(the tuna is less money so why not anyway.) He had personally not tried the sandwich before with that fish but it was oh so delicious. Tuna was excellent .A good amount of fish, nice bite from the cabbage. The cream wasn’t too horseradishy but I guess it is actually good here as it allows you to taste the fish fully. As per their other sandwiches, it came with some lemon. Nice guy as well. This is quite literally my happy place. I cannot say enough good things about the food here, not merely because it is well priced for the quality, but because everything I’ve had here tastes rustic and homemade, as if it was literally prepared by your favorite Scandinavian aunt. There is no bullshit here– handwritten signs adorn all items with price written in ballpoint pen, where many mysterious goodies lay pickled or smoked, and a stuffed bear hovers above, guardian of all things fishy and fine. The stand is manned by one person who takes their time, and I couldn’t imagine it any other way. They run out of bread on busy days, but the fish plate is great too. Faves: The Nordic sandwich, smoked trout, deviled eggs, any of the rotating quiches, elderflower lemonade.

It’s quite depressing to see that Essex Street Market lacks the foot traffic necessary for places like Nordic Preserve to thrive as much as it should. If this joint was located elsewhere there’d be a line to the door daily. Their smoked salmon sandwich prepared with cabbage slaw and homemade horseradish cream on a fresh and crispy baguette is a delicious steal at $ 10.00. The meal was prepped delicately including the on-order whipping of the horseradish cream. I wish this place much success and will continue to patronize for my smoked salmon needs on the Lower East(yes just as good and far more affordable than R&D).

Awesome! I had no idea this place, or Essex Market, existed! I’ve only been once but I immediately fell in love. Though a one man show from a tiny little booth, there is quite a bit of variety! I had the gravlax sandwich and it was amazing. Possibly the best lox I’ve had in NYC and I eat a lot of nordic food and bagels. The salmon was buttery in flavor and drizzled with a lemon sauce, dill, and piled on top of a pickled mix all between a delicious little baguette. They also offered various sweets, and of course svenska köttbullar(swedish meatballs). Though this isn’t quite the replacement for the recently closed nordic deli in BK, it is a nice affordable alternative for those who want some nordic food but don’t want to shell out the cash for Skal, Aquavit, or aamanns. I am so glad that this place has opened in the essex market. No more waiting on line at Russ and Daughters for me. They seem to have the same selections of smoked salmon that russ’ s have. Norwegian, scottish, belly lox etc. but also smoked eel. tuna and other stuff russ doesn’t have. it’s Scandinavian and has licorices and other candy from the Nordic countries plus big rolls of crispbread, which I have not seen elsewhere. It’s a cute design with lots of pale wood and a giant reindeer head overlooking all. I had the nordic sandwich, which came on a ciabatta. Home cured graxlax with some kind of smetana or crème fresh. and a crunchy pico de gallo. The roosters beak, Delicious! However, that night I dreamt that a giant chicken was eating me.
